As will become obvious, I have little scripting experience. I'm trying to imitate an amusement park type ride. One sits in a spinning 'car' at the end of an arm which revolves about a central hub. So, I build a cube-hub, a cylinder arm and a cube-car and link them with the cube-hub as the root. Next I insert this simple script into the cube-hub and also into the cube-car: default { state_entry() { llTargetOmega(<0,0,1>,.2,1.0); } } From afar, he cubes move as I want them to. When I sit on the cube-hub, I revolve nicely. BUT, when I sit on the cube-car, the cube revolves beneath me! My avatar instead rotates relative to the hub. From reading the forums, I THINK that either what I'm trying can't be made to work or that I need to put extra code in the child prim about Get and Set Local rotation.
